commentFUNCTION Histone methyltransferase that dimethylates histone H3 at 'Arg-17', forming asymmetric dimethylarginine (H3R17me2a), leading to activate transcription via chromatin remodeling (PubMed:28930672). Maternal factor involved in epigenetic chromatin reprogramming of the paternal genome in the zygote: mediates H3R17me2a, promoting histone H3.3 incorporation in the male pronucleus, leading to TET3 recruitment and subsequent DNA demethylation (PubMed:28930672).CATALYTIC ACTIVITY L-arginyl-[protein] + 2 S-adenosyl-L-methionine = N(omega),N(omega)-dimethyl-L-arginyl-[protein] + 2 S-adenosyl-L-homocysteine + 2 H(+)SUBUNIT Interacts with HSPA5, HSP90B1, TUBULIN, UGGT1 and UGGT2 (By similarity). Interacts with TET3 (PubMed:28930672). Interacts with STPG4 (PubMed:28930672).SUBCELLULAR LOCATION Localizes in male and female zygote pronucleus and cytoplasm.TISSUE SPECIFICITY Ubiquitously expressed.DISRUPTION PHENOTYPE Mice give birth to significantly smaller litter sizes (PubMed:28930672). Moreover, about a third of the homozygous newborn mice die before weaning and only a few survive to adulthood (PubMed:28930672). Strongly reduced 5-hydroxymethylcytosine (5hmC) levels in zygotes (PubMed:28930672).SIMILARITY Belongs to the methyltransferase superfamily.
